Default b16a w/AC in an 88crx si

Well this is one of my few post on HT ive been around for awhile but most questions i have are solved with the search function...thanks guys for all the help you give...... but ive come to a hult. ... heres my question.......I have a 88 crx si with a b16a swap it came with ac and from the looks of it its in good shape. My question is will it work in my 88 crx si. What will i need to do this? Will the si ac lines work on the b16a compressor, will i need to buy the hasport ac bracket for it to fit?
